m0ssy wrote:
Was this information published somewhere? I'd appreciate learning how to know in advance, as I want to spot as many charters at EUG as possible. Thanks for all the help! :D

Yes it is very easy. Just look at their football schedule to see what games they have at home. For Saturday games the opposing team's will usually arrive on Friday afternoon so be checking Flightaware on Friday morning under the Enroute or Scheduled Arrivals. As soon as they file the flight plan to EUG it will show up. Can also track Oregon's away games the same way, look for a plane being ferried in empty that morning to carry the team out later.

**Remember for events like this the away teams are escorted from hotel to game, so a normal "pretty good bus ride" becomes a lot quicker!


Years ago, one of the universities I was at played at Southern Miss. In addition to runway/airport issues for the charter, the team has a lot of decisions to make about staff/equipment/families/travel party/etc.

My school flew a DL 757 into and out of Jackson because that was nearest hotels that met the all the things the football program needed. We had an awesome group of Mississippi Highway Patrol officers doing our escort from Jackson to Hattiesburg. It was a QUICK trip, compared to how long the drive might normally take.
